CHS 1 Hike - Wallace Falls

Enjoy three beautiful waterfalls just outside Gold Bar on this CHS hike led at a CHS 1 pace (1.5-2.0 mph).

  • Moderate
  • Moderate
  • Mileage: 6.0 mi
  • Elevation Gain: 1,300 ft
  • Pace: 1.5-2.0 mph

This is a popular hike.  We'll meet in the Wallace Falls State Park parking lot with boots on by 7:30am and hit the trail by 7:45am.  Discover Pass required. Flush toilets available.

Getting there: Proceeding East on Hwy 2, approach the city of Gold Bar. Turn left onto 1st Street, then drive .4 miles and take a right onto May Creek Rd (there will be Wallace Falls signage for both turns).

Snake your way up May Creek Rd for 1.3 miles until you reach a Y-junction. Right will take you into Camp Huston, so proceed left and drive up a short path into the Wallace Falls State Park parking lot.

Ten Essential Systems

  1. Navigation (map & compass)
  2. Sun protection (sunglasses & sunscreen)
  3. Insulation (extra clothing)
  4. Illumination (headlamp/flashlight)
  5. First-aid supplies
  6. Fire (waterproof matches/lighter/candle)
  7. Repair kit and tools
  8. Nutrition (extra food)
  9. Hydration (extra water)
  10. Emergency shelter (tent/plastic tube tent/garbage bag)
